Transit visa, short stay ...
Haiti > Suriname
Transit visa, short stay ... Haiti Swaziland
Transit visa, short stay ... Haiti Syria
Transit visa, short stay ... Haiti Tajikistan
Transit visa, short stay ... Haiti Taiwan
Transit visa, short stay ... Haiti Tanzania